/* fixed social*/

.stickey_social_icons {
    padding: 0px;
}

#fixed-social {
    position: fixed;
    top: 130px;
    /* margin-left: 96%; */
    z-index: 9999;
}

#fixed-social a {
    color:#013d79;
    display: block;
    width: 47px;
    height: 40px;
    position: relative;
    text-align: center;
    line-height: 40px;
    margin-bottom: 1px;
    z-index: 2;
    padding: 0px!important;
	 border-radius: 25px;
	 font-size:19px;
}

#fixed-social a:hover>span {
    /* visibility: visible;
   left: 41px;
   opacity: 1; */
    visibility: visible;
    left: 41px;
    opacity: 1;
    margin-right: -165px!important;
}

#fixed-social a span {
    line-height: 40px;
    left: 60px;
    position: absolute;
    text-align: center;
    width: 120px;
    visibility: hidden;
    transition-duration: 0.5s;
    z-index: 1;
    opacity: 0;
	 border-radius: 25px;
}

.fixed-facebook {
    background-color:#ffffff!important;
}

.fixed-facebook span {
    background-color: #00AAE5;
}

.fixed-twitter {
    background-color: #ffffff;
}

.fixed-twitter span {
    background-color: #7D3895;
}

.fixed-gplus {
    background-color: #ffffff;
}

.fixed-gplus span {
    background-color: #00AF54;
}

.fixed-linkedin {
    background-color: #ffffff;
}

.fixed-linkedin span {
    background-color: #FFC41E;
}

.fixed-instagrem {
    background-color:#ffffff;
}

.fixed-instagrem span {
    background-color: #ED2B29;
}

.fixed-tumblr {
    background-color: #ffffff;
}

.fixed-tumblr span {
    background-color: #EB1471;
}


/*end fixed social*/




.right_sticky_menu {
    padding: 0px;
}

#fixed-right_menu {
    position: fixed;
    top: 130px;
    /* margin-left: 96%; */
    z-index: 9999;
}

#fixed-right_menu a {
    color: #fff;
    display: block;
    width: 47px;
    height: 40px;
    position: relative;
    text-align: center;
    line-height: 40px;
    margin-bottom: 1px;
    z-index: 2;
    padding: 0px!important;
	 border-radius: 25px;
	 font-size:19px;
}

#fixed-right_menu a:hover>span {
    /* visibility: visible;
   left: 41px;
   opacity: 1; */
    visibility: visible;
    left: 41px;
    opacity: 1;
    margin-right: -165px!important;
}

#fixed-right_menu a span {
    line-height: 40px;
    left: 60px;
    position: absolute;
    text-align: center;
    width: 120px;
    visibility: hidden;
    transition-duration: 0.5s;
    z-index: 1;
    opacity: 0;
	 border-radius: 25px;
}